HaynesPro buys E3 Technical to boost tech data business

HaynesPro, the professional data solutions business of Haynes Publishing Group is strengthening its online technical data presence with the acquisition of E3 Technical.


The acquisition sees HaynesPro taking on all of E3 Technical’s direct and indirect business from Carweb Ltd, a subsidiary of Solera Holdings Inc. This includes: Repair and Maintenance Information (RMI); Vehicle Registration Mark (VRM) look-up software, associated helpdesks and a number of Carweb’s employees. All customer contracts relating to the E3 Technical business will transfer to HaynesPro.

HaynesPro is the European market leader for online automotive workshop data, serving more than 50,000 workshops through its European partners. It has been collaborating with Carweb since 2009.

Haynes says the acquisition will deepen HaynesPro’s relationships with automotive professionals with the addition of E3 Technical’s support desk and VRM services allowing HaynesPro to enhance services. The E3 Technical team will now have direct access to HaynesPro’s WorkshopData and the RMI database which is based on manufacturers’ information. A team of high-level data and IT staff will also ensure an uninterrupted supply of services and data across its customer base.

Peter van der Galiën, Managing Director of HaynesPro, said, "This acquisition is an important milestone in our European growth strategy and significantly enhances HaynesPro’s data offering.  Having worked with the E3 Technical team for many years, we know that we are bringing on board the best talent and capabilities in the industry.”

Darryl Watts, former E3 Technical Sales Director and new HaynesPro UK Managing Director, said, "We are excited to be joining the HaynesPro team. The acquisition reflects our strong commitment to providing UK partners and customers with the best possible technical data solutions. It also guarantees the continuity of existing services, without any interruptions during the hand-over, and ensures the development of future products to meet customer and partner needs.”
